Analyst Confidence Amidst Market Adjustments

Raymond James analysts recently reaffirmed their 'Outperform' rating for Barrick Mining Corporation (NYSE:B), even as they adjusted the price target slightly downwards from $62 to $61. This decision underscores a continued belief in the company's fundamental value and its capacity to generate superior returns within the mining industry.

Strategic Asset Portfolio and Cash Flow Generation

The positive outlook stems from Barrick's substantial holdings in premium gold mines and valuable copper deposits. These assets are crucial for sustaining robust cash flow. A key driver of this success was the acquisition of Randgold, which introduced Barrick to world-class assets and significantly improved its prospects for free cash flow.

Expanding Global Footprint: The Nevada Joint Venture

Further enhancing its operational capabilities, Barrick established a joint venture with Newmont in Nevada. This collaboration has cemented Barrick's presence in one of the world's most prolific gold regions, paving the way for substantial synergies and operational efficiencies.

Navigating Challenges: Security and Capital Allocation

Despite its global ambitions, Barrick has encountered hurdles, particularly in Pakistan, where security concerns have necessitated a slowdown in the development of certain copper and gold projects. In response, the company is implementing a strategy to reduce capital expenditure while maintaining agile management practices across its portfolio.

A Global Leader in Mineral Extraction

Barrick Mining Corporation (NYSE:B) operates as a leading international mining firm, actively involved in the exploration, development, production, and sale of both gold and copper resources. Its operations span 18 countries, focusing on high-margin, long-life mines primarily in Africa, North America, South America, and Saudi Arabia, underscoring its broad geographical diversification and strategic market positioning.
